Art Curation For Golf Spaces

Curating art for golf clubhouses and courses demands careful deliberation. The chosen pieces should mirror the identity of the course and chime with its members. Teaming up with local artists can infuse a unique, regional flavor, celebrating the community’s cultural lineage. It also bolsters the local arts community, nurturing a reciprocal relationship between the golf club and the artists.

Moreover, rotating exhibitions can maintain an invigorating and dynamic environment, sparking frequent visits from members keen to see the latest additions. This evolving approach to art curation ensures that the clubhouse remains a lively, metamorphosing space, akin to the game of golf itself.
